A rich Flemish beef and onion stew simmered with dark beer and bread. It is a signature dish of Lille and northern France, reflecting the region's brewing heritage.
A crisp tart made with Maroilles cheese, a strong local cow's milk cheese from the region. It is one of the most emblematic savory specialties around Lille.
Mussels served with fries, popular in Lille brasseries and during the Braderie. The dish reflects the city's Belgian influence and long-standing regional food culture.

Moderate for France. Hotels and dining are often cheaper than Paris, while transit is affordable and many sights are low-cost.
Service is usually included. Round up or leave 5-10% for great restaurant service, round up taxis, and leave small change in cafes.
